Background: Giant cell tumor of bone (GCTB) is a benign but locally aggressive osteolytic neoplasm that most commonly presents as a solitary lesion in long bones. Multicentric GCTB is rare, comprising fewer than 1% of all cases, and metachronous involvement of two distinct regions within the same bone is exceptionally uncommon. Case presentation: We report the case of a 22-year-old man who initially presented with a 2-year history of right knee pain. Radiologic and histopathologic evaluation confirmed a Campanacci grade III GCTB of the distal femur, which was treated with intralesional curettage, polymethylmethacrylate augmentation, and adjuvant radiotherapy. Seven months later, he developed new-onset right hip pain. Imaging revealed a separate osteolytic lesion of the proximal femur. Histopathology confirmed a second GCTB lesion, establishing the diagnosis of multicentric metachronous disease. Clinical discussion: The development of a second histologically confirmed GCTB within the same femur shortly after treatment of the primary lesion represents a rare diagnostic and therapeutic challenge. Distinguishing metachronous multicentric disease from intramedullary skip lesions and metastatic or metabolic bone disease is critical, as management and prognosis differ substantially. The recommended treatment for GCTB is curettage, but this may not be possible when the lesion is located in the proximal femur. Conclusion: This case highlights an exceptionally rare presentation of a metachronous, multicentric GCTB occurring in different regions of the same long bone. Vigilant long-term radiologic surveillance is essential.
